Maes Yr Haf Road, Neath - Temporary Road Closure For Railway Bridge Maintenance Works
What is happening?
NEATH PORT TALBOT COUNTY BOROUGH COUNCIL
CYNGOR BWRDEISTREF SIROL CASTELL-NEDD PORT TALBOT
(MAES YR HAF ROAD, NEATH) (TEMPORARY ROAD CLOSURE) ORDER 2025
NOTICE is hereby given that Neath Port Talbot County Borough Council intend in not less than seven days from the date of this Notice to make an Order under Section 14(1)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 (as amended).
The effect of the Order will be to temporarily prohibit vehicular traffic from proceeding along the length of road set out in the Schedule below whilst the Order is in force. During such periods as are indicated by traffic signs informing the public that the road is closed.
The Order is necessary to enable Network Rail to carry out essential railway bridge maintenance works in the road.
The Order will come into force on the 22th September 2025 and shall continue in force for a maximum duration of 18 months, or until the works are completed whichever is the sooner. It is anticipated that the works will take 1 night to complete between the hours of 11pm and 6am.
SCHEDULE
Maes Yr Haf Road, Neath will be closed from its junction with Windsor Road in a westerly direction for a distance of 70m along its length.
The alternative route for vehicular traffic will be via The Parade, Croft Road, Riverside Drive, Prince of Wales Drive, Gnoll Park Road, St Davids Street, Orchard Street, London Road and Alford Street.
Access for pedestrians and emergency vehicles will be maintained at all times.
